From e4ba42514bb4559e46409764fa21a70b793411a9 Mon Sep 17 00:00:00 2001 From: zou_lin77 <422351577@qq.com> Date: Sat, 29 May 2021 10:54:47 +0800 Subject: [PATCH] do not use systemd to restart services with RefuseManualStart=true --- sssd.spec | 19 ++++++++++++------- 1 file changed, 12 insertions(+), 7 deletions(-) diff --git a/sssd.spec b/sssd.spec index f6af046..3bb7e7e 100644 --- a/sssd.spec +++ b/sssd.spec @@ -1,6 +1,6 @@ Name: sssd Version: 2.2.2 -Release: 6 +Release: 7 Summary: System Security Services Daemon License: GPLv3+ and LGPLv3+ URL: https://pagure.io/SSSD/sssd/ @@ -541,23 +541,25 @@ fi %postun %systemd_postun_with_restart sssd-autofs.socket -%systemd_postun_with_restart sssd-autofs.service %systemd_postun_with_restart sssd-nss.socket -%systemd_postun_with_restart sssd-nss.service %systemd_postun_with_restart sssd-pac.socket -%systemd_postun_with_restart sssd-pac.service %systemd_postun_with_restart sssd-pam.socket %systemd_postun_with_restart sssd-pam-priv.socket -%systemd_postun_with_restart sssd-pam.service %systemd_postun_with_restart sssd-ssh.socket -%systemd_postun_with_restart sssd-ssh.service %systemd_postun_with_restart sssd-sudo.socket -%systemd_postun_with_restart sssd-sudo.service %systemd_postun_with_restart sssd-kcm.socket %systemd_postun_with_restart sssd-kcm.service %systemd_postun_with_restart sssd-ifp.service /sbin/ldconfig +# Services have RefuseManualStart=true, therefore we can't request restart. +%system_postun sssd-autofs.servece +%system_postun sssd-nss.service +%system_postun sssd-pac.service +%system_postun sssd-pam.service +%system_postun sssd-ssh.service +%system_postun sssd-sudo.service + %posttrans %systemd_postun_with_restart sssd.service %{_sbindir}/update-alternatives \ @@ -577,6 +579,9 @@ fi %{_libdir}/%{name}/modules/libwbclient.so %changelog +* Sat May 29 2021 zoulin - 2.2.2-7 +- do not use systemd to restart services with RefuseManualStart=true + * Sat Sep 19 2020 Liquor - 2.2.2-6 - install default sssd.conf file -- Gitee